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

l'Esplanade commands the best view in Domme, with stunning vistas from the rooms, restaurant and terrace cafe tables. It is family owned and operated from the exemplary chef to the warm reception by his wife and daughter. The restaurant is not open every night this time of year, but is outstanding. Parking was surprisingly easy nearby, and the breakfast was simple but fresh. A village bistro offers excellent food as an alternative when the restaurant is closed, and outstanding chateaux, caves, and restaurants are nearby. A wonderful base for our five days.
